PURPOSE:To reduce a natural shrinkage factor, and to obtain a film excellent even in printing properties by quenching the film so as to reach to a specific temperature or lower, annealing it within a specific temperature range and quenching it. CONSTITUTION:When manufacturing a polypropylene group heat-shrinkable film, a tubular film discharged from a dice 1 is cooled and solidified by a cooling ring 2, and heated by a heater 8, and a gas is encapsulated after the heating. The film is quenched at 30 deg.C or lower by cooling rolls 9, annealed at 50-75 deg.C in an annealing tank 10, and quenched at 30 deg.C or lower by cooling rolls 11, a gas is encapsulated among nip rolls 6, 7, and the film is wound by a rotating winder through a guide roll 12. Accordingly, a natural shrinkage factor is reduced, and the heat-shrinkable film, which is not tightened through winding and is excellent in smoothness while it can also be printed, can be obtained. |
